I wish Bungie had approached the game the way Bioware approached Mass Effect 3, where the multiplayer is involved with the story, yet is completely separate from the campaign. I think the best thing to do with Destiny at this point is to have each character have a "Crucible loadout" where everyone has access the exact same guns with the exact same perks, everyone gets one of each type of gun to choose from (ie high rate of fire, high impact, etc). Keep PvE weapons using the same system we have now, they just can't be used in Crucible. This way Crucible would be entirely skill based without god rolls dominating the playing field at all times and PvE won't get shit upon due to god rolls in Crucible.
